Understanding the firmware's limits requires looking at the WS330's internal hardware: RAM: 32 MB. Flash Memory: 4 MB. Speed: Wireless N300 (up to 300 Mbps on 2.4 GHz). Ports: 1x WAN, 4x LAN (10/100 Mbps). Official Firmware Management
Huawei provides two main methods to ensure your router is running the latest official software:
AI Life App: Connect your phone to the router's Wi-Fi, open the Huawei AI Life App, select your router, and navigate to Updates to check for manual or automatic installs.
Web-Based Interface: Log in to the router's management page (usually 192.168.3.1) via a browser. Look for the Maintenance or System tab to find the firmware upgrade section. "Extra Quality" and Third-Party Alternatives

While there is no formal academic paper titled specifically "Huawei WS330 firmware extra quality," there are several technical resources and studies regarding the Huawei WS330
router and general security concerns with Huawei's firmware. Technical Analysis of the Huawei WS330
The Huawei WS330 is an older, budget-friendly router model. Technical reviews and teardowns highlight its stable but aging hardware platform. Hardware Specifications : It features 32 MB of RAM and 4 MB of Flash memory. Firmware Capabilities
: The stock firmware (e.g., version V100R001C199B012) supports features like 802.1Q VLAN tagging
, allowing it to work with various internet service providers that require traffic tagging. Physical Features : It includes a physical WLAN/WPS button
that can be held for 15-20 seconds to completely disable the Wi-Fi module. Comparative Studies and Security Research
Academic and industry reports have analyzed Huawei's firmware development "quality" and security standards extensively: Vulnerability Reports : Independent studies, such as the Finite State Report
, found that Huawei firmware often contained significantly more known security vulnerabilities compared to industry rivals. Firmware Update Flaws Firmware Update Vulnerabilities
notes that inadequate access controls in the delivery phase of updates can allow compromised firmware to be installed without proper on-device verification. Specific Exploits
: Research into similar Huawei home routers has identified specific threats like firmware upload without authentication
, where updates could be sent to a device via broadcast packets to overwrite memory without a password. Official Resources for Firmware

The Huawei WS330 is a legacy N300 wireless router designed for home and small office use. While it is a stable workhorse, finding "extra quality" firmware typically refers to the latest official updates that improve stability or community-modified versions that unlock advanced networking features. Latest Official Firmware Overview
The most reliable way to ensure "extra quality" performance is to use the final stable release from Huawei. The latest known stable version index for this model is V100R001C199B012 . Key Improvements in Official Updates:
VLAN Support: Better compatibility with Russian and European ISPs requiring 802.1Q tagging .
Security Patches: Fixes for legacy WPA2 vulnerabilities and firewall improvements.
Stability: Optimized memory management for its 32 MB RAM to prevent crashes during high traffic . How to Upgrade for "Extra Quality" Performance
To ensure your firmware is at its highest quality, you can update it using two primary methods: 1. Manual Update (Web Interface)
Login: Connect to the router and go to 192.168.3.1 (or your default gateway) in a browser. Use the default credentials (usually admin/admin) .
Navigation: Go to Maintenance > Device Management > Firmware Upgrade.
Upload: Download the specific .bin or .cc file for your region from the Huawei Support Portal and upload it manually . 2. Automatic Update (AI Life App)
If your hardware version supports it, you can use the Huawei AI Life App: Connect your phone to the WS330 Wi-Fi. Open the app and select the router. Go to Updates and select Check for Updates . Advanced "Extra Quality" Features
For users looking to push the WS330 beyond its standard capabilities, community modifications (often found on forums like 4PDA or GitHub) focus on:
WDS Bridging: Allows the WS330 to act as a range extender for other routers .
QoS Management: Better control over bandwidth for specific devices (e.g., prioritizing a work laptop over a gaming console) .
Antenna Optimization: Leveraging the 3D-coverage provided by its two external and one internal antenna for better wall penetration . ⚠️ Critical Safety Warning
Power Stability: Never disconnect power during a firmware flash. This will "brick" the router, making it unusable .
Version Matching: Ensure the firmware matches your specific hardware version (e.g., WS330-20 vs WS330-10). Flashing the wrong version can cause permanent hardware failure.
